Remove the `q' suffix on x86-64 atomic instructions.
|
|
|
|
We don't need the `q' suffix on x86_64 atomic instructions for AO_t,
|
|
which is defined as "unsigned long". "unsigned long" is 32bit for x32
|
|
and 64bit for x86-64. The register operand in x86-64 atomic instructions
|
|
is sufficient to properly determine the register size.
